The Russian Navy will receive the small missile boat "Stupinets" of Project 12418, code "Molniya," in 2025. It was built at the Vympel shipyard in Rybinsk.
The first of the pair of small missile boats being built in Rybinsk is scheduled to be handed over to the Russian Navy in 2025.
According to the source, initially, two MRKs were being built in Rybinsk for a foreign customer. After they refused to purchase them, the Russian Navy became interested in the boats, and they were equipped with weapon systems necessary for the naval forces.
The boats of Project 12418 carry the "Uran" anti-ship missile system with Kh-35 missiles, the AK-630M anti-aircraft system, and the AK-176 artillery mount. Presumably, the "Stupinets" will join the Caspian Flotilla.
Main characteristics of Project 12418:
- Full displacement — 580 t
- Main dimensions (length, width, draft) — 56.9x10.2x2.4 m
- Maximum/economic speed — 29/14 knots
- Cruising range — 2900 nautical miles
- Endurance — 10 days
- Seaworthiness — 8 points
